How to Mend a Broken Heart
Autor Christine Webberen Limba Engleză Paperback – 23 aug 2016
Nowadays, very few of us remain in the same relationship from eighteen to eighty. This means that upheaval and heartbreak are part of life and may happen several times to all of us. Once you have accepted your loss, you'll be in a good position to find love, and to be loved, again
